Scottohiocpa Posted May 11, 2014 #3 Share Posted May 11, 2014 I have upgraded from inside to outside or balcony many times with no problem. If the price of new location is lower you don't get the difference refunded, but they do give you the better room. We are booked on the Glory May 31 and I started out with an inside for $2500 for 4 people and when the price dropped I got to change to a balcony for $2180. They did give me a refund of the difference this time because we had not reached the date when the final payment was due. Technically if they had not let me do it, I would have cancelled my original booking and lost the $200 deposit, then rebooked the balcony for $2180. It still would cost less for a better room even with the $200 forfeiture.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
